Gray's Creek Middle School

5151 Celebration Drive
Hope Mills, NC 28348

Serving 1,068 students in grades 6-8, Gray's Creek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 43% (which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 51%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 48% (which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 50%).
The student-teacher ratio of 18:1 is higher than the North Carolina state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 56%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 58% (majority Black).

Gray's Creek Middle School's student population of 1,068 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 59 teachers has declined by 13% over five school years.
